There Actually Is a Plan: How Democrats Can Save Us and Keep Winning (w/ Ben Wikler)
About this episode
America can feel like it's spiraling out of control—but could a state like Wisconsin hold the blueprint for turning things around? Ben Wikler, former chair of the Democratic Party of Wisconsin and author of the new book This Is the Plan: How to End America's Meltdown and Save Democracy, joins Stacey Abrams to explain why the answer is yes. Drawing on Wisconsin's political battles, Wikler argues that Democrats can win back voters ahead of the midterms by learning from closely divided states that have successfully pushed back against Republicans. They discuss how Democrats can sharpen their messaging, the lasting impact of gerrymandering, whether it's finally time to abolish the Electoral College, and the power we all have to make a big difference by organizing locally.
